Parts and Tools Required
In addition to the microinverters, PV modules, mounting rail, and associated hardware, you will need the
following.
Enphase Equipment
Enphase Envoy™ Communications Gateway
•
Engage Cable, as needed
•
NOTE: Order the correct Engage Cable type. Use 5G2.5 Engage Cable at sites with three-
phase service, or use 3G2.5 Engage Cable at sites with single-phase service. Check the
labelling on the drop connectors to verify the voltage type.
Sealing caps, as needed (for any unused drops on the Engage Cable)
•
Terminators, as needed (one needed at the end of each AC branch circuit)
•
Enphase disconnect tool (number 2 and 3 Phillips screwdrivers can be substituted)
•
Other Items
AC Junction boxes
•
Gland or strain relief fitting (one per AC junction box)
•
Bonding (Earthing) conductor
•
Torque wrench, sockets, spanners for mounting hardware
•
Adjustable spanner or open-ended spanner (for terminators)
•
Tool for PV module locking connectors
•
Handheld mirror (to view indicator lights on the undersides of the microinverters)
•
Laptop or other computer for Envoy set up
•
Lightning Surge Suppression
Lightning protection and resulting voltage surge are protected in accordance with BS 7671. It is assumed that
the PV modules are installed in accordance with related standards and that the microinverter is a part of a
broader lightning protection system in accordance with BS 7617.
In some areas, the statistical frequency of lightning strikes near a PV installation is high enough that lightning
protection must be installed as part of an Enphase system. In some areas, a surge protection device might be
mandatory following a risk analysis, according to local regulation, BS 7671.
